There are meet ups every week pretty much organised in the discord. I think people have been busy so it hasn't been advertised as much as it was and is much smaller than it used to be. If you look on Facebook you will see the meetup group and friendship group as well, but the Facebook groups aren't very active these days, it's mostly discord. There are board games meetups too.
Market tav has the Wednesday night karaoke night, that is fun but can be a bit rowdy. Other places do occasional events, and pride is in September.
We do need more, a city of this size no longer having any lgbtq venues is sad.
